Modified STARR
I have problem of obstructive Defecation..I also have SRUS..Previous doctors recommended STARR surgery...Today met a new doctor who said he would do STARR only but in a modified manner by inflating the rectum with CO2,and would place cameras through bigger proctoscope for clarity because in STARR procedure there is less visualization..I want to know whether this procedure is Ok or not..He also said blood and mucus passage will stop but whether defecation will be smooth or not,will be understood after the surgery only..I want to know is this procedure good?kindly tell me..Please help me take the correct decision..
